2013年12月3日 星期二

java 判別字母大小寫 隨機產生一字母






package cc.home;
public class LetterCheck {
 public static void main(String[] args) {
         char symbol = 'A' ;  //設定為字元
         symbol = (char)(128.0*Math.random());  //隨機產生0-127隨機字元
        
         if (symbol >= 'A'){    //如果大於A 字元
          if(symbol <= 'Z'){ // 如果小於 Z字元
           System.out.println("you have the capital letter "+symbol); //印出結果 大寫英文A-Z
          }
          else  {
           if (symbol >= 'a') { // 如果大於 小寫a 字元
            if (symbol <= 'z'){  //如果小於 小寫z 字元
             System.out.println("you have the small letter "+symbol ); //印出結果 小寫a-z
                 }else {
                     System.out.println("篩選1");   // 全部不符合      
                       }           
            }else {
                    System.out.println("篩選2"); //不是大寫A-Z
                      }
            }        
              } else {
                      System.out.println("篩選3");//不是小寫a-z
                        }
         }

 }

沒有留言:

張貼留言